It's testing as corrosive primed in the 5.45x39 thread.

Buffman tested both calibers and both were corrosive.

Which was no surprise to me.

All of the steel cases imports are likely to have corrosive primers.

Russian ammo is mostly non-corrosive but every once in a while a corrosive batch would show up.
